Default Shrimp Sauce or other dipping or "drizzle" sauces.

Quite often, I have rolls that have a sauce drizzled over them in a
beautiful display and also adding a wonderful taste to the roll
sections.

Does anyone here have any recipes for sauces they've made and used for
similar purposes?

I can't eat very spicy foods, but mildly spicy is ok.

One place I go has a "Shrimp Sauce" that is really, really good. It's
a creamy sauce that has a mayo type consistency and a slightly spicy
flavor. They drizzle it lightly over the face of the pieces of roll.

I asked, and they buy it in bulk.

I would like to make my own for this purpose.
